Reversible Cerebral Vasoconstriction Syndrome along with Posterior Reversible Encephalopathy Syndrome in a Postnatal Eclamptic Patient: A Case Report
Reversible Cerebral Vasoconstriction Syndrome (RCVS) and Posterior Reversible Encephalopathy Syndrome (PRES) are rare neurological disorders.
